Because, you see, the Punjab Police, specifically its sharp-eyed counter-intelligence wing working in tandem with the formidable ATS, stepped in. They moved, swiftly and decisively, arresting an individual who, for all intents and purposes, was poised to plunge the region into chaos.
His name is Amritpal Singh, and what a discovery it was: not just a person, but a walking, breathing package of potential destruction. Officers recovered not one, but two improvised explosive devices. IEDs. Just think about that for a moment. Devices designed for maximum impact, for terror. And alongside them? A pistol, a blunt instrument of immediate harm. This wasn't some minor street crime; this was a deliberate, calculated plot, nipped firmly in the bud, right there on the outskirts of the city.
But this wasn't just any random arrest, a stroke of pure luck. Oh no. This operation, like so many crucial ones, was built on solid, actionable intelligence. It was a testament to the painstaking, often thankless work of those who piece together fragmented clues, who sift through the whispers and shadows to reveal concrete threats. And what they uncovered pointed directly to a deeply concerning network.
Singh, it turns out, is allegedly a pawn in a much larger, more sinister game—a terror operative connected to one Lakhbir Singh, who operates under the chilling alias 'Landa.' Landa, for those unfamiliar, is no stranger to headlines, unfortunately. He’s the Pakistan-based handler, the puppeteer, linked to an alarming array of past incidents. Remember that rocket attack on the Punjab Police intelligence headquarters in Mohali? Or perhaps the RDX delivery that was intercepted? Yes, those, too, have Landa’s fingerprints all over them.
